Pros

Industry leader and expanding offerings and services capabilities provide Insight with great potential. Benefits are decent for a large corporation. They have recently added some more innovative benefits like an on-site health clinic and on-site health screenings to improve health consciousness among the teammates. They have a nice holiday party and some fun perks from the partners in the call center. Good management training programs for front line managers are provided, if you can find the time to attend. Onsite cafeteria at the Harl location, although it's overpriced and food isn't healthy or good. Free vendor food is common and better than the cafeteria food!

Cons

Constant change is strategy and senior leadership is often times short sighted, but in the name of growth. Constant change is particularly frustrating to the sales organization who's expectations, accounts, managers, etc are frequently changing. There is a tremendous lack of sales accountability and rigor. Sales training is poor and sales management, with some exceptions, is poor. The culture is deteriorating and morale is currently very low. Systems are very outdated, but there is a lot of work being done to improve in this area. Pay overall is below market average. Insight is trying to evolve into a modern day company, but still has a lot of school mentality which makes the shift difficult. Lots of silos and favoritism still exists. There is no empowerment and you need to go through a million approvals for the most basic and common sense things. Lots and lots of meetings. Very little respect for work/life balance or time off. You are expected to ALWAYS be accessible.
